Milton Sirotta, nephew of American mathematician Edward Kasner

He is known for coining the word 'googol' in 1938 when he was eight years old. His uncle, the mathematician Edward Kesner (1878-1955) asked him what name he would have given to a "1" followed by 100 zeros and "google" was then answer. You could also call the number a 10 duotrigintillion.
